10 Harbert is a 24 bed medical-surgical unit with a focus on the following specialties: Neurology, Neurosurgery, Orthopedics, and Rehabilitation services. Eight beds are designated for the Epilepsy Monitoring Unit. We provide patient/family-focused, quality-driven nursing services for pediatric patients ranging from neonates to adolescents. Our unit has a strong focus on patient and family education. This focus allows the nurses working on our unit the opportunity to grow personally and professionally. Our staff prides themselves on working as a team with our main goal being to provide not only quality patient care but excellent customer service as well. The Epilepsy Monitoring Unit (EMU) is an 8-bed mini-unit located on 10H. The EMU is designated Level 4 by the National Association of Epilepsy Centers (NAEC). Level 4 is the highest level for units that specialize in the care of epilepsy patients including seizure evaluation through a treatment plan. The Epileptologist, Nurse Practitioners, and Technicians are highly trained specialists in the evaluation and treatment of epilepsy through GRID and stereoelectroencephalographical placement and surgery.

Since 1911, Children’s of Alabama has provided specialized medical care for ill and injured children. Ranked among the best children’s hospitals in the nation by U.S. News & World Report, Children’s serves patients from every county in Alabama and nearly every state. With more than 3.5 million square feet, it is one of the largest pediatric medical facilities in the United States. Children’s offers inpatient and outpatient services at its Russell Campus on Birmingham’s historic Southside with additional specialty services provided at Children’s South, Children’s on 3rd and in Huntsville and Montgomery. Primary medical care is provided in more than a dozen communities across central Alabama. Children’s is the only health system in Alabama dedicated solely to the care and treatment of children. It is a private, not-for-profit medical center that serves as the teaching hospital for the University of Alabama at Birmingham (UAB) pediatric medicine, surgery, psychiatry, research and residency programs. The medical staff consists of UAB faculty and Children’s full-time physicians as well as private practicing community physicians.
